Subject: Re: drivers/ieee1394/sbp2.c:734: error: `host' undeclared (first use in this function) 2.6.3-bk3
Date: Fri, 27 Feb 2004 07:07:38 -0800	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<403F5D3A.4080101@oatmail.org> (raw)

All,

This is the same change I made in my local tree against 2.6.3-bk4. It 
was pretty much a blind change, so I have no idea if it's the right 
thing to do or not, but it certainly compiles now. I've connected a few 
firewire devices and they appear to work as expected without anything 
going belly-up, so it's good enought for me. I guess only Bob really 
knows if that's what he meant.
